Aviation training centre BAA Training (Vilnius, Lithuania) and Transport and Telecommunications Institute (Riga, Latvia) are inviting to the open door day in order to introduce newly developed Engineering Science in Aviation Transport and ATPL(A) pilot license studies program. The event will take place on the 29th of August at the TSI facilities in Riga, Latvia.

The newly developed studies program is aimed to prepare the professionals for the competitive aviation market which is in need of the competent pilots and knowledgeable engineers and technical staff. The theoretical part of the bachelor degree studies will take place at TSI in Riga, while the practical flight training will be performed in either Lithuania or Latvia.

During the event which will start at noon, representatives of BAA Training and TSI will briefly introduce both education institutions, provide the industry prospective, program benefits and will gladly answer any questions that audience will have regarding the studies, flight training, professors, program accreditation and other.
